Tapio Schneider is a scholar working on Atmospheric Science, Global and Planetary Change and Oceanography. According to data from OpenAlex, Tapio Schneider has authored 160 papers receiving a total of 10.3k indexed citations (citations by other indexed papers that have themselves been cited), including 125 papers in Atmospheric Science, 116 papers in Global and Planetary Change and 35 papers in Oceanography. Recurrent topics in Tapio Schneider’s work include Climate variability and models (101 papers), Meteorological Phenomena and Simulations (76 papers) and Atmospheric and Environmental Gas Dynamics (35 papers). Tapio Schneider is often cited by papers focused on Climate variability and models (101 papers), Meteorological Phenomena and Simulations (76 papers) and Atmospheric and Environmental Gas Dynamics (35 papers). Tapio Schneider collaborates with scholars based in United States, Switzerland and United Kingdom. Tapio Schneider's co-authors include Paul A. O’Gorman, Tobias Bischoff, Gerald H. Haug, Arnold Neumaier, Simona Bordoni, Xavier J. Levine, Christopher C. Walker, Ori Adam, Junjun Liu and Adam H. Sobel and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Physics Today.
